HTML 속성과 SEO: 웹페이지 최적화의 핵심
웹페이지의 기초는 HTML로 만들어집니다. 하지만 많은 사람들이 이 기본 요소의 중요성을 간과하고 있습니다. 효과적인 SEO 전략을 구축하기 위해서는 HTML의 구조와 속성을 이해하는 것이 필수적입니다. 이번 포스트에서는 SEO와 관련된 HTML 속성들에 대해 알아보겠습니다.
HTML 속성이란?
HTML 속성은 HTML 요소에 추가적인 정보를 제공하는 특성입니다. 예를 들어, <link rel="canonical" href="https://www.example.com" />
와 같은 코드에서, rel
과 href
는 각각 이 링크의 관계와 주소를 설명하는 속성입니다. 속성은 명칭과 값으로 구성되어 있으며, 페이지 콘텐츠에 대한 중요한 맥락을 제공합니다.
주요 HTML 속성
-
name 속성: 주로
<meta>
태그와 함께 사용되며, 검색 봇에 특정 정보를 제공하기 위해 사용됩니다. 예를 들어,<meta name="robots" content="noindex" />
는 해당 페이지가 검색 엔진에 인덱싱되지 않도록 지시합니다. -
noindex 속성: 페이지가 검색 엔진의 색인에 포함되지 않도록 할 때 사용되는 속성입니다. 일반적으로 민감한 콘텐츠를 보호하기 위해 사용합니다.
-
description 속성: 메타 설명으로 알려진 이 속성은 SERPs(검색 결과 페이지)에서 페이지에 대한 요약을 제공합니다. 클릭 유도를 위한 서머리로 기능하지만, 랭킹에는 영향을 미치지 않습니다.
-
href 속성: 링크를 정의하는 데 사용됩니다. 예를 들어,
<a href="www.example.com">클릭하세요</a>
와 같이 사용되어 사용자가 클릭하는 링크의 목적지를 나타냅니다. -
rel="nofollow" 속성: 특정 링크가 검색 엔진에 의해 따라가지는 않도록 지시하는 속성입니다. 광고 또는 후원 링크에 주로 사용되어, 검색 엔진 최적화에 악영향을 미치지 않도록 합니다.
-
hreflang 속성: 다국어 콘텐츠를 가진 웹사이트의 경우, 어떤 언어의 페이지를 사용자에게 보여줘야 하는지를 지시합니다. 이를 통해 검색 엔진이 사용자에게 최적의 언어 버전을 제공할 수 있습니다.
-
canonical 속성: 동일한 콘텐츠가 여러 페이지에 있을 때, 검색 엔진이 어느 페이지를 주 콘텐츠로 간주할지를 지정합니다. 이를 통해 검색 엔진의 혼란을 방지할 수 있습니다.
-
src 속성: 이미지의 위치를 지정하는 데 사용됩니다. 이미지가 다른 도메인에 있을 경우에는 전체 URL을 사용해야 합니다.
-
alt 속성: 이미지에 대한 대체 텍스트로, 이미지가 표시되지 않을 경우에 대신 제공됩니다. 검색 엔진이 이미지를 더 잘 이해할 수 있도록 도와줍니다.
왜 HTML 속성이 중요한가?
HTML 속성은 웹사이트의 구조를 명확히 하고, 검색 엔진이 페이지를 이해하는 데 필요한 정보를 제공합니다. 특히, SEO에서 중요한 배역을 하며, 검색 봇이 웹페이지를 제대로 크롤링하고 제공하는 데 필수적입니다.
각 속성을 올바르게 설정하면, 동일한 컨텐츠에 대해서도 검색 엔진이 의도하는 대로 더 적절한 방법으로 인식할 수 있습니다. 또한, 사용자 경험을 향상시키기 위해 필수적인 요소이기도 합니다.
결론
SEO와 HTML의 관계는 침체없이 이어지는 중요한 요소입니다. HTML 속성을 이해하고 적절하게 활용함으로써, 검색 엔진 최적화를 강화시킬 수 있습니다. 학생들을 포함한 모든 SEO 전문가들은 HTML의 기초적인 속성과 그 역할을 인식해야 합니다. 이를 통해 더 나은 웹사이트와 콘텐츠 전략을 구축할 수 있습니다.
더 많은 정보를 원하신다면, W3Schools HTML 가이드에서 HTML과 관련링 내용들을 확인해보세요!